Facilities Ticket — Cleaning Crew Access, Brindle Annex

For new starters handling evening lock-up: the Sorano Cleaning crew arrives nightly at 21:30 via the annex side door. Check their rota sheet, note arrival in the log, and ensure the storeroom is relocked afterward. To let them through the side door, enter the access code below.

badge for yaweg-hafog: bdg-GX-6

TURN-208: Gatevale turnstile counters at the Merrow Field pilot double-count when a rotation reverses mid-cycle. Attendance totals drift roughly 2% high per event. The debounce window fix is implemented, reviewed by Ilsa, and soak-tested across two simulated match days without drift. Ready for your cut; the candidate build is identified below.

trace token, tagag-tafog: htk6_5ed18c

**Ticket PZ-4412: Expired credentials — Gridwright crossword generator**

Welcome, new folks — this ticket is a good first look at our credential flow. The Gridwright generator stopped fetching clue banks from the Lexivault service last night because its API key passed the 90-day expiry. Symptoms: empty puzzle grids and `401` entries in the generator logs. A fresh key has been issued by the platform team and verified against staging. Update the `LEXIVAULT_KEY` entry in the generator's config map with the replacement key provided below.

gateway credential: qvz15-KH6w5OvQFD1Z8FT

Handover: Exportron retry queue

Hi Mira — handing over the failed-export retries. Exports that hit a timeout land in the retry queue and get three attempts with backoff; after that they're parked and need a manual requeue from the admin panel. Watch for customers reporting duplicates — that usually means a double requeue. The current retry settings are as follows.

settings of bajog-fawig:
oliael:
  log_level: warn
  metrics_host: metrics.oliael.zemvarsys.internal
  pin: 0267
  pool_size: 32